Global Thiophene Market: Overview

The thiophene market encompasses the production and distribution of thiophene, a heterocyclic compound with a five-membered ring containing sulfur, widely used as a building block in organic synthesis for pharmaceuticals, agrochemicals, and advanced materials.

In summary, the market is driven by expanding applications in drug development and electronic materials, increasing demand for sustainable chemicals, and growth in emerging economies, while restrained by raw material price volatility and environmental regulations; key trends include the rise of bio-based thiophene derivatives, advancements in conductive polymers, and focus on high-purity grades for specialized uses.

Market Dynamics

Growth Drivers

  • Increasing Demand in Pharmaceutical and Agrochemical Sectors

Thiophene's unique chemical properties make it essential for synthesizing complex molecules in drugs and pesticides, with rising global health concerns and agricultural needs boosting consumption.

Technological advancements in synthesis methods enhance yield and purity, while expanding R&D in biopharmaceuticals creates new applications, supported by investments in emerging markets.

Restraints

  • Volatility in Raw Material Prices and Supply Chain Issues

Dependence on petroleum-derived feedstocks leads to price fluctuations influenced by oil markets, impacting production costs and profitability for manufacturers.

Geopolitical tensions and supply disruptions in key producing regions further exacerbate challenges, while competition from alternative heterocycles limits market share in cost-sensitive applications.

Opportunities

  • Advancements in Organic Electronics and Polymers

The growth of flexible electronics and conductive polymers opens avenues for thiophene derivatives in OLEDs and solar cells, driven by the push for renewable energy solutions.

Sustainability trends favor bio-based thiophene production, with potential in green chemistry initiatives and partnerships for innovative materials in high-tech industries.

Challenges

  • Stringent Environmental Regulations and Safety Concerns

Compliance with global standards on sulfur compounds and emissions requires significant investments in eco-friendly processes, posing barriers for smaller players.

Health risks associated with handling thiophene necessitate advanced safety measures, while market fragmentation and intellectual property issues hinder standardized growth.

Global Thiophene Market: Segmentation Analysis

The Thiophene market is segmented by derivative type, application, and region.

Based on Derivative Type Segment, the Thiophene market is divided into 2,5-Dimethylthiophene, 2,3-Dimethylthiophene, 3-Methylthiophene, 2-Methylthiophene, and others. The 2-Methylthiophene segment is the most dominant, holding approximately 35% market share, due to its widespread use as an intermediate in fragrances and pharmaceuticals, which drives the market by enabling cost-efficient synthesis and meeting high-volume demands in diverse industries. The 3-Methylthiophene segment is the second most dominant, with around 25% share, valued for its stability in polymer applications, contributing to market growth through advancements in conductive materials and electronics.

Based on Application Segment, the Thiophene market is divided into pharmaceuticals, agrochemicals, electronics, polymers, and others. The pharmaceuticals segment dominates with about 50% share, owing to thiophene's critical role in drug development for treatments like antibiotics and anti-inflammatories, propelling market expansion by supporting global healthcare innovations and R&D investments. The agrochemicals segment follows as the second dominant, capturing roughly 20% share, driven by its use in herbicides and fungicides, aiding market growth amid increasing food production needs and sustainable farming practices.

Global Thiophene Market: Regional Analysis

  • Asia Pacific to dominate the global market

Asia Pacific holds the largest share in the thiophene market, approximately 40%, fueled by extensive manufacturing capabilities and demand from pharmaceuticals and agrochemicals. China dominates within the region as the leading producer and exporter, supported by low-cost raw materials and government incentives for chemical industries; rapid urbanization and investments in R&D further drive consumption, with local firms innovating in high-purity thiophene for global supply chains.

Europe captures around 30% of the market, emphasized by advanced research in organic electronics and strict quality standards. Germany leads the region with its strong chemical sector and focus on sustainable synthesis; EU regulations promote green alternatives, enhancing thiophene's role in polymers and pharmaceuticals through collaborations and technological patents.

North America accounts for about 20% share, driven by pharmaceutical innovations and electronic applications. The United States is the dominant country, where FDA approvals and venture funding boost thiophene usage in drug intermediates; key players invest in scalable production, addressing supply needs in biotech and materials science.

Latin America and the Middle East & Africa together hold the remaining share, with growth in agrochemicals. Brazil leads in Latin America due to agricultural expansions, while South Africa dominates MEA with emerging chemical processing; international trade supports market entry, fostering local production and exports.
